Dataset description

The Central Personal Register (CPR) is a central, nationwide basic register. The main purpose is to assign to everyone living in Denmark a personal identification number (CPR number) for their secure identification. In addition, it is a purpose to register basic personal data about the persons concerned, such as the address of residence, which may be disclosed to public authorities and private individuals who have a legitimate interest in doing so. The CPR thus contains only personal data related to the data subjects. The CPR administration operates through the Central Personal Register as a central provider of personal data to public authorities and to the private sector. The CPR administration is organisationally located in the Ministry of Social Affairs and the Interior.
